Crafting a Wife’s Letter to Support Her Husband’s Court Case
Writing a letter to support your husband in a court case can feel a bit daunting, but with the right structure and heartfelt words, you can make a powerful impact. The goal of this letter is to highlight your husband’s personality, contributions, and any circumstances surrounding the case that could sway the judge’s opinion positively. Let’s break down the optimal structure for this letter.
1. Start with Basic Information
At the top of your letter, include this basic information:
Detail | Example |
---|---|
Your Address | 123 Your St, Your City, Your State, 12345 |
Date | January 1, 2023 |
Judge’s Name | Honorable John Doe |
Court Name | XYZ District Court |
Case Number | Case #12345 |
2. Salutation
Next, start with a respectful greeting. Something simple like:
“Dear Honorable Judge Doe,”
3. Introduction
In your opening paragraph, introduce yourself. Share your relationship with your husband and briefly explain the purpose of your letter.
For example:
“My name is [Your Full Name], and I am [Husband’s Name]’s wife. I am writing this letter to share my thoughts and experiences with him as he faces these challenging circumstances.”
4. Body Paragraphs: Share Personal Insights
This section is where you can tell your husband’s story and influence the judge’s perspective. Aim for 2-3 paragraphs that cover:
- Your Husband’s Character: Describe his qualities—kindness, supportiveness, responsibility—and include specific examples.
- Impact on Family: Briefly explain how his situation affects the family unit, focusing on emotions and responsibilities he carries.
- Context of the Situation: Provide context around the case—what led to it, any misunderstandings, or extenuating circumstances that deserve consideration.
For instance, you might write:
“[Husband’s Name] is an amazing father and husband. I remember when he stayed up all night to help our son with his science project. He’s always there for our family, emotionally and financially. Given the current situation, it’s been tough on our kids seeing their dad stressed out. His absence would impact us significantly.”
5. Closing Statement
Wrap it up by reiterating your support and reinforcing his positive attributes. You can also include a gentle reminder of the importance of family and community.
Something like:
“I wholeheartedly believe that [Husband’s Name] is not only a good man but also someone who deserves a chance to continue to provide for our family. I ask you to consider this when making your decision.”
6. Sign-Off
End with a respectful closing. A simple:
“Thank you for taking the time to read my letter.”
Follow that up with:
“Sincerely,”
Then add your signature and print your name below it. Example:
[Your Signature]
[Your Printed Name]
7. Additional Tips
Here are some quick pointers to keep in mind while writing your letter:
- Keep it respectful and formal, even though you’re writing from the heart.
- Try to keep it to one page. Brief and concise is best!
- Proofread for typos or errors. Presenting a polished letter shows you care.
- Always stay truthful—don’t exaggerate or misrepresent your husband’s character or actions.

How can a wife effectively write a letter of support for her husband in a legal matter?
To write an effective letter of support for her husband, a wife should follow a structured approach. First, she should start by stating her purpose clearly. This may involve explaining her relationship with her husband and the nature of the legal issue. Next, she should describe his character traits and positive attributes. Sharing specific examples can make these statements more credible. The wife should address any relevant issues involved in the case, if applicable, while maintaining a respectful tone. Finally, she should conclude with a strong statement of faith in her husband’s integrity. Keeping the letter concise and focused increases its impact.
